Yoga is an ancient practice that combines physical postures, breathing techniques, and meditation. It originated in India and is practiced for its many mental and physical health benefits.

No, you do not need to be flexible to start yoga. Flexibility is a result of a consistent yoga practice, not a prerequisite for it. Yoga is for all body types and abilities, and poses can be modified to suit individual needs

The benefits of practicing yoga are extensive. Regular practice can improve flexibility, strength, and balance, reduce stress and anxiety, and promote better sleep and overall well-being.
